Winehouse’s emotionally charged music uniquely intertwined jazz and hip-pop and reached millions of listeners. She released two albums in her career, Frank and Back to Black. Winehouse was well known for her unique image, particularly her large beehive styled dark hair and her thick black eyeliner.

Sadly, Winehouse’s life was punctuated by controversy, throwing almost constantly in the tabloids. Amy Winehouse lost her life at the age of 27 from alcohol poisoning, leaving fans devastated. Throughout her career and beyond her death she has been highly regarded and awarded as one of the most talented musicians of her time who has left an inconceivably significant legacy in music.
